プログラムに関する用語

スパゲッティプログラムとは?分かりやすく解説

-スパゲッティプログラムの特徴- スパゲッティプログラムは、コード構造が複雑で「スパゲッティ」のように絡み合った状態のことを指します。この特徴的なコード構造により、次の問題が発生します。 * -コードの読み書きが困難- コードが複雑で絡み合っているため、ロジックを理解したり、変更したりすることが難しくなります。 * -バグ検出が困難- スパゲッティプログラムでは、バグを特定するのが非常に困難です。コードが複雑に絡み合っているため、どのコードがバグを引き起こしているのかを特定することが困難だからです。 * -メンテナンス性の低さ- スパゲッティプログラムは、更新や拡張が困難です。コードが絡み合っているため、新しい機能を追加したり、バグを修正したりすることが、非常に時間がかかり、エラーが発生しやすい作業となります。 * -再利用性の低さ- スパゲッティプログラムは、他のシステムやコンポーネントで再利用するのが困難です。コードが絡み合っているため、分離したり、他のシステムに統合したりすることが難しいからです。
WEBサービスに関する用語

データを守る!バックアップの暗号化設定完全ガイド

クラウドサービスについての質問 ITの初心者 クラウドサービスを使ったバックアップは、どのように行うのですか? IT・PC専門家 クラウドサービスを使ったバックアップは、まずご自身が利用したいクラウドストレージにアカウントを作成します。そし...
WEBサービスに関する用語

高可用性と信頼性を極める!WEBサービス設計の基本原則

高可用性と信頼性に関する質問と回答 ITの初心者 高可用性とは具体的にどのような技術や手法が使われるのでしょうか? IT・PC専門家 高可用性を実現するためには、負荷分散、冗長構成(クラスタリング)、およびフェイルオーバー機能などが挙げられ...
インフラに関する用語

キャリアとは?IT用語をわかりやすく解説

キャリアとは、個人の職業上の経歴や経験の積み重ねを示す用語です。単に一定期間の雇用関係にとどまらず、蓄積されたスキル、知識、能力を指します。キャリアは生涯を通じて構築され、その人の専門性と将来の展望を形成します。 ITにおけるキャリアは、急速に変化する技術環境の中で、常に新しいスキルや知識を習得することが求められます。そのため、IT業界では、キャリア形成に意識的なアプローチが不可欠です。
WEBサービスに関する用語

APIの監視と解析 システムの健全性を保つためのガイド

APIについての質問と回答 ITの初心者 APIを使うことで、どんな利点がありますか? IT・PC専門家 APIを使うことで、他のサービスやデータを簡単に取り入れることができるため、開発スピードが向上します。また、プログラムの再利用性が高ま...
WEBサービスに関する用語

TLS設定の自動テスト徹底ガイド testssl.shとsslscanで安全性を極める

TLSに関する質問と回答 ITの初心者 TLSはどのように機能するのですか? IT・PC専門家 TLSは、クライアントとサーバーの間で秘密の鍵を交換し、その鍵を使ってデータを暗号化します。これにより、データは外部から覗かれにくくなり、安全に...
ハードウェアに関する用語

メモリ速度超過の解消法 パフォーマンス向上のための完全ガイド

メモリに関する質問 ITの初心者 メモリはなぜ重要なのですか? IT・PC専門家 メモリは、プログラムやアプリケーションを実行する際に必要なデータを迅速にアクセスできるようにするため非常に重要です。メモリの容量が大きいと、同時に多くの作業を...
WEBサービスに関する用語

公共Wi-Fiの危険を撃退!iOSで使えるNordVPN完全ガイド

NordVPNに関する会話 ITの初心者 NordVPNの利用は本当に安全ですか?どんなことに気をつければいいのでしょうか? IT・PC専門家 はい、NordVPNは強力な暗号化技術を使用しており、データを安全に保護します。ただし、信頼でき...
ネットワークに関する用語

IT用語『トラフィック』とは?意味と種類を解説

トラフィックとは、ネットワークやシステムに流れるデータの総量を指す用語です。インターネット、企業のイントラネット、電話回線など、あらゆるデータ通信システムに存在します。トラフィックはビット/秒(bps)やメガビット/秒(Mbps)で測定され、データがネットワーク上を流れる速度を表します。データの送信元と宛先、使用される通信プロトコル、ネットワークの容量などの要因によってトラフィックの量は異なります。
ネットワークに関する用語

時分割多重接続(TDMA)とは?仕組みとメリット

時分割多重接続(TDMA)とは、限られた帯域幅を複数のユーザー間で分配するために使用される多重アクセス方式です。この方式では、各ユーザーに帯域幅の特定の時間スロットが割り当てられ、その時間スロット内でのみ送信が許可されます。TDMAにより、複数のユーザーが同時に同じ周波数を使用して通信できるようになります。
WEBサービスに関する用語

DNSの全貌 再帰DNSと権威DNSの違いを徹底解剖!

DNSに関する質問と回答 ITの初心者 DNSサーバーはどのように機能するのですか? IT・PC専門家 DNSサーバーは、ドメイン名に対してIPアドレスを提供する役割を持っています。ユーザーがウェブサイトにアクセスしようとすると、まず再帰D...
WEBサービスに関する用語

IT用語『W3C』って何?WWWコンソーシアムって?

WWWコンソーシアムとは、World Wide Webの標準化と進化を促進する、非営利団体です。1994年に設立され、Webの技術的発展を監督し、Webのオープンで互換性のある性質を確保することを目的としています。この組織のメンバーには、主要なブラウザ開発者、Web開発者、企業、学術機関などが含まれており、Webの将来を形作る上で重要な役割を果たしています。
WEBサービスに関する用語

IBM Security QRadarによる不正アクセス検知とフィッシング対策の最前線

QRadarに関する質問と回答 ITの初心者 QRadarはどのようにして脅威を検出するのですか? IT・PC専門家 QRadarは、ログ情報やネットワークフローを集約し、機械学習を用いて異常なパターンを分析します。これにより、既知の脅威だ...
WEBサービスに関する用語

ユーザーインターフェース最適化ガイド 効果的な手法と成功事例を徹底解説

シンプルなデザインについての質問 ITの初心者 シンプルなデザインのUIがなぜ重要なのですか? IT・PC専門家 シンプルなデザインは、ユーザーが直感的に操作できるようにし、迷うことなく目的を達成できる環境を提供します。また、視覚的な煩雑さ...
その他

IT用語『ファイル形式』を徹底解説

ファイル形式とは、コンピュータ上のデータをどのように格納して処理するかを定義する仕様です。デジタルデータは、画像、ドキュメント、オーディオ、ビデオなど、さまざまな形式で存在しますが、それぞれの形式は独自の構造とルールを持っています。ファイル形式は、データがどのようにエンコードされ、どのように解釈されるかを決定します。たとえば、画像ファイル形式のJPEGは、画像データを圧縮して保存するのに対し、ドキュメントファイル形式のPDFは、文字やレイアウト情報を保持して保存します。ファイル形式は、データの互換性、アクセス、編集に大きな役割を果たしています。
ネットワークに関する用語

メール配信リスト「メーリングリスト」とは?仕組みと活用法を解説

メーリングリストとは、特定のトピックや関心分野に興味を持つ人々の電子メールアドレスの集合体です。メール配信を行うには、リストを作成し、加入者を集めます。希望者がメールアドレスを入力すると、アドレスがリストに追加されます。 メーリングリストの仕組みはシンプルです。リストの所有者は、リストにメールを送信すると、そのメールはリスト内のすべての加入者に届きます。加入者は、受信したメールに返信したり、リストから離脱したりすることができます。
WEBサービスに関する用語

Twitterハッシュタグ活用術 トレンド分析から成功事例まで徹底ガイド

ハッシュタグに関する質問と回答 ITの初心者 ハッシュタグはどのように使えばいいですか? IT・PC専門家 ハッシュタグは投稿の内容に関連するキーワードを選び、これを文の中に「#」をつけて書くことで使います。例えば、話題が「プログラミング」...
ハードウェアに関する用語

無線マウスとは?ワイヤレスマウスとの違い

-無線マウスの特徴- 無線マウスは、コードレスでコンピュータに接続するマウスです。ワイヤレスマウスとは異なり、パソコン本体とレシーバーを接続する「無線接続」ではなく、Bluetooth接続で接続します。そのため、USBポートを使用せず、レシーバーを紛失する心配もありません。 Bluetooth接続によって、10メートルを超える範囲で操作が可能になります。加えて、電波干渉の少ない2.4GHz帯を使用しているため、混雑した環境でも安定した接続を保ちます。また、低消費電力設計により、単3電池または内蔵バッテリーで長時間使用できます。
パソコンに関する用語

CPU温度を制する者はフリーズを制す!効果的な冷却と管理法

CPUの温度管理についての会話 ITの初心者 CPU温度が高くなると、どのような影響がありますか? IT・PC専門家 CPU温度が高くなると、動作が遅くなったり、システムがフリーズしたり、最悪の場合はハードウェアが損傷する可能性があります。...
パソコンに関する用語

PDFの互換性と編集トラブル解決ガイド スムーズなファイル管理のために

PDFフォーマットについての質問 ITの初心者 PDFフォーマットって、どんな時に使われるんですか? IT・PC専門家 PDFフォーマットは、ビジネス文書や報告書、教育資料など、文書の内容やレイアウトを維持したい場合に最適です。さまざまなデ...
パソコンに関する用語

BAD_POOL_HEADERエラー徹底解説 原因と修正法、予防策まで全カバー!

BAD_POOL_HEADERエラーについての質問と回答 ITの初心者 BAD_POOL_HEADERエラーが出たのですが、何が原因でしょうか? IT・PC専門家 このエラーは、主にメモリ管理の問題が原因です。ドライバーの不具合や、ハードウ...
パソコンに関する用語

ネットワーク接続エラーを解消!Officeアップデートをスムーズに進めるための完全ガイド

Wi-Fi接続トラブルに関する会話 ITの初心者 Wi-Fiが急に接続できなくなってしまいました。どうしたらいいでしょうか? IT・PC専門家 まずは、ルーターの電源を切って再起動してみてください。それでも接続できない場合は、Wi-Fiのパ...
ハードウェアに関する用語

拡張メモリーカードとは?

拡張メモリーカードとは、デジタルカメラやスマートフォンなど、電子機器のストレージ容量を拡張するための追加可能な記憶媒体です。メモリーカードスロットと呼ばれるデバイスの専用ポートに挿入することで、デバイスの内部ストレージを補完します。
WEBサービスに関する用語

PrestaShop完全ガイド デザイン編集とモジュールカスタマイズのすべて

PrestaShopに関する質問と回答 ITの初心者 PrestaShopを始めるために、どのような技術的知識が必要ですか? IT・PC専門家 PrestaShopは初心者向けに設計されていますが、基本的なHTMLやCSSの知識があるとカス...